I use the same rods and really like them for the money. Couple 100+ pounders been caught on them so plenty of backbone. If you like to anchor in the hydros with 20+ oz of sinkers you may need to beef up but other than that good all purpose rod.
Google tangling with catfish rods and you'll find em. A buddy of mine started the line but has since sold the biz to a guy in IL. They are still selling well.
